One-stage Revision With Catheter Infusion of Intraarticular Antibiotics Successfully Treats Infected THA

摘要

Two-stage revision surgery for infected total hip arthroplasty (THA) is commonly advocated, but substantial morbidity and expense are associated with this technique. In certain cases of infected THA, treatment with one-stage revision surgery and intraarticular infusion of antibiotics may offer a reasonable alternative with the distinct advantage of providing a means of delivering the drug in high concentrations.We describe a protocol for intraarticular delivery of antibiotics to the hip through an indwelling catheter combined with one-stage revision surgery and examine (1) the success as judged by eradication of infection at 1 year when treating chronically infected cemented stems; (2) success in treating late-onset acute infections in well-ingrown cementless stems; and (3) what complications were associated with this approach in a small case series.Between January 2002 and July 2013, 30 patients (30 hips) presented to the senior author for treatment of infected THA. Of those, 21 patients (21 hips) with infected cemented THAs underwent débridement and single-stage revision to cementless total hip implants followed by catheter infusion of intraarticular antibiotics. Nine patients (nine hips) with late-onset acute infections in cementless THA had bone-ingrown implants. These patients were all more than 2 years from their original surgery and had acute symptoms of infection for 4 to 9 days. Seven had their original THA elsewhere, and two were the author's patients. All were symptom-free until the onset of their infection, and none had postoperative wound complications, fever, or prolonged pain suggestive of a more chronic process. They were treated with débridement and head and liner exchange, again followed by catheter infusion of intraarticular antibiotics. During this time period, this represented all infected THAs treated by the senior author, and all were treated with this protocol; no patient underwent two-stage exchange during this time, and no patients were lost to followup. At the time of the surgery, two Hickman catheters were placed in each hip to begin intraarticular delivery of antibiotics in the early postoperative period. Antibiotics were infused daily into the hip for 6 weeks with the tubes used for infusion only. Eleven of the single-stage revisions and four of the hips treated with débridement had methicillin-resistant Staphylococcus aureus. Patients were considered free of infection if they had no clinical signs of infection and had a normal C-reactive protein and erythrocyte sedimentation rate at 1 year. Complications were ascertained by chart review.Twenty of 21 (95%) infections in patients who had single-stage revision for chronically infected cemented THA were apparently free from infection and remained so at a mean followup of 63 months (range, 25-157 months). One case grew Candida albicans in the operative cultures and remained free of signs of infection after rerevision followed by infusion of fluconazole. The nine cementless THAs treated with débridement and head/liner exchange all remained free of signs of infection at a mean followup of 74 months (range, 62-121 months). Few complications were associated with the technique. Four patients had elevated serum levels of vancomycin without renal function changes and two patients had transient blood urea nitrogen/creatinine elevations with normal vancomycin levels that resolved with dosage adjustments. No patient had evidence of permanent renal damage. None of the patients in this study developed a chronic fistula or had significant drainage from the catheter site.Single-stage revision for chronically infected cemented THA and débridement of bone-ingrown cementless THA with late-onset acute infection followed with indwelling catheter antibiotic infusion can result in infection eradication even when resistant organisms are involved. Larger study groups would better assess this technique and prospective comparisons to more traditional one- and two-stage revision techniques for infected THA will likely require multi-institutional approaches.Level IV, therapeutic study.
